Hi, welcome to the Kestrel storage team. One thing you'll hit on-call: we run a bloom filter in front of the Tindra key-value store to avoid disk lookups for missing keys. False positives are expected; a rising false-positive rate usually means the filter needs resizing, which is a manual operation. The resizing procedure and alert thresholds are documented on this page.

operations page: https://jira.qorvelsys.internal/browse/pages/browse/pages

**Vendor note: Inkmill markdown pipeline**

Rendering for Parchway docs is outsourced to Inkmill under an annual contract, renewing each March. They handle sanitization and PDF export; we own the upload queue. SLA: 4-hour response on rendering failures. Escalate only after two failed retries. Their support desk is reachable at the address below.

billing contact of hahaf-baguf = zorael.tammir.jorius@sivrelhq.internal

**Q: I've lost my badge — what now?**

No panic. Pop over to the facilities desk on Level 2 of Harkwell House and let us know roughly when and where you last had it. We'll deactivate the old badge straight away and print you a loaner for the day. To activate the loaner at the turnstiles, use the code below.

door code, yagap-bahof: bdg-O-05

- [ ] Step 7: Archive cold storage buckets (Glacierline tier). Confirm both ceremony witnesses are present, verify bucket manifests match the Oxbow ledger, then seal the archive key shares. Plugin authors may observe but not handle shares. Once sealed, the archive index itself is encrypted and can only be reopened with the passphrase below.

vault phrase of badup-hahig = tamael-aldael-kelmir-istael-fenok-istwyn-tamius-jorath-oliion